Common Goal Setting Mistakes
- Lack of Specificity: When goals are too vague, they lead to confusion and a lack of direction. For example, saying, “I want to be healthy” lacks clarity. Instead, a specific goal would be, “I aim to exercise for 30 minutes, five days a week.” This precision allows you to visualize the means to achieve your aspiration.
- Unrealistic Expectations: Setting unattainable goals can create unnecessary frustration and a sense of failure. Many individuals in Nigeria may aspire to become millionaires overnight, but real success often requires patience, persistence, and realistic planning. Understand that goals should push you but remain reachable; for instance, aiming for a 20% increase in savings over a year is much more viable than an immediate 100% jump.
- Failure to Track Progress: Without assessing your progress, it’s easy to lose motivation and eventually abandon your goals. A student preparing for university entrance exams might benefit from regularly evaluating their study habits and material comprehension to stay on track towards their targeted scores.

Proven Tips for Success
- Define Clear Goals: Utilize the SMART criteria—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ound. This structured approach ensures that goals are clear and actionable, such as setting the aim to enroll in a professional course by the end of the year, ensuring it adheres to all the SMART principles.
- Break Down Larger Goals: Dividing larger objectives into manageable steps fosters enduring motivation. For instance, if the goal is to start a small business, preparatory steps might include conducting market research, developing a business plan, and securing funding—each step bringing you closer to the ultimate goal.
- Seek Accountability: Sharing your goals with a friend, mentor, or community group can enhance your commitment to achieving them. In Nigeria, where communal connections are strong, leveraging these relationships can provide support, encouragement, and even resources to stay on track.

Understanding the Key Mistakes in Goal Setting
As you embark on your path to success, it’s essential to identify typical pitfalls that can derail your goal-setting efforts. The following mistakes often hinder progress:
- Ambiguity in Goals: Vague goals like “I want to be successful” provide no clear direction. Instead, articulate your goals with precision. For example, specifying, “I will increase my income by 30% in the next year through freelance graphic design” makes the objective clear and actionable.
- Ignoring Realistic Limitations: Aspiring for the extraordinary is commendable, but setting goals without considering your current resources or time constraints can lead to disillusionment. For instance, setting a goal to lose 20 kilograms in a month without a proper diet and workout plan can result in failure and disappointment. Aim for gradual, achievable targets that inspire rather than frustrate.
- Neglecting Accountability: Keeping goals to yourself can often diminish your sense of responsibility. Sharing your targets with trusted friends or accountability partners is a powerful motivator. In the Nigerian context, forming goal-setting groups among peers can create a supportive network that fosters commitment and camaraderie.

Essential Strategies for Effective Goal Setting
- Implementation of SMART Goals: The SMART framework—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ound—provides clarity and structure. Rather than simply stating, “I want to improve my career,” a more impactful goal would read: “I will complete a project management certification by December 2024 to elevate my career prospects.”
- Incremental Progress Strategies: Large ambitions can feel overwhelming; breaking them down into smaller, achievable tasks is key. If launching an online business is your ultimate goal, start with smaller objectives—research your niche, develop a business plan, and identify your initial investment. Each completed step fuels your motivation and confidence.
- Celebrate Milestones: Recognizing achievements, no matter how small, can maintain momentum. When a student completes all required readings ahead of exam preparation, celebrating this success fosters a positive mindset necessary for ongoing effort.

Utilizing Visualization Techniques
Visualization is a powerful technique employed by many successful individuals. By vividly imagining your goals, you create a mental picture of success that can propel you toward achievement. For example, a budding entrepreneur can visualize running a successful restaurant in Lagos, picturing the ambiance, the taste of the dishes, and the happy patrons enjoying their meals. This mental imagery not only fuels motivation but also reinforces the belief that these aspirations are attainable.
Aligning Goals with Personal Values
When your goals resonate with your core values, the motivational spark is ignited. Understanding what truly matters to you can lead to more meaningful objectives. For instance, if community service is a core value, setting a goal to volunteer at a local NGO in Nigeria may provide a deeper sense of purpose than merely striving for financial gains. This alignment fosters commitment and persistence, promising a more fulfilling journey.
The Role of Flexibility in Goal Setting
Life’s unpredictability often means that sticking rigidly to a pre-set goal can be counterproductive. The importance of adaptability cannot be overstated; enhancing your goals as circumstances evolve is crucial. A Nigerian tech professional, for instance, may initially set a goal to learn a programming language in six months. However, if demanding work hours hinder progress, reassessing the timeline and adjusting the goal to a broader timeframe like nine months can maintain motivation without inducing feelings of failure.
Incorporating Regular Reviews
Progress is often not linear. Establishing a routine for reviewing your goals—be it weekly, monthly, or quarterly—can provide valuable insights into what is working and what requires adjustment. During these reviews, assess not only what you have achieved but also recognize any barriers that may have arisen. Embracing this reflective practice encourages growth, and a continuous feedback loop allows for timely course corrections, ultimately leading to enhanced outcomes.
Creating a Vision Board
A vision board is an engaging and creative way to keep your objectives top-of-mind. By collating images, quotes, and representations of your goals, you create a visual reminder of what you’re striving for. Whether it’s a new car, starting a business, or traveling across Nigeria, having a vision board prominently displayed can serve as a daily motivator. Numerous success stories highlight individuals who have turned their vision boards into reality through focused, sustained effort.
Leveraging Technology for Goal Management
In today’s digital era, a plethora of apps and tools can aid in tracking your goals effectively. Using applications such as Trello or Asana can help organize tasks and deadlines. Additionally, reminders and alerts can keep you on track, ensuring that your goals remain a priority. This tech-savvy approach is particularly beneficial for Nigeria’s urban dwellers, balancing both professional duties and personal aspirations.
